Web19 mrt. 2024 · After his LSU career, Shaquille O'Neal played in the NBA from 1992-2011. He was a member of the Orlando Magic, Los Angeles Lakers, Miami Heat, Phoenix Suns, Cleveland Cavaliers, and Boston Celtics.

WebBy high school graduation in 1989 O'Neal was fully grown. He stood 7-feet-1-inch tall, wore a size 22 shoe, and was recruited intensively by coaches from major colleges. O'Neal opted to play with Coach Brown and the Tigers at LSU in Baton Rouge. O'Neal, playing at center, was named to the All-American first team during his freshman year at LSU. Web17 nov. 2024 · Shaq entered his Golden Years in LA, winning three titles from 2000 through 2002. The break-up with LA was a little rough and mirrored the Orlando fiasco. Shaq was unhappy with the other star on the team, Kobe Bryant, and had trouble sharing the team with him. To be fair to Shaq, Kobe had the exact opposite approach to basketball.
